Navigating Your Financial Path: Mortgage Broker vs. Financial Advisor

Buying a property is a significant milestone. It often involves navigating the complex world of finance, and knowing whether to work with a mortgage broker or a financial advisor can be challenging. is a mortgage broker a financier Both professionals can provide valuable assistance, but their focuses differ.

A mortgage broker specifically helps you find a financing for your property purchase. They work with diverse lenders to assess loan offers and find the best terms that suit your needs.

On the other hand, a financial advisor takes a more holistic approach to your finances. They can counsel you on a wider range of topics, including investing.

Consider your specific objectives. If your primary desire is to find the most suitable mortgage, a mortgage broker is the right choice. If you are looking for complete financial guidance, a financial advisor is a better fit.

Some individuals may gain advantage from working with both a mortgage broker and a financial advisor to attain their full financial aspirations.

Analyzing the Part: Are Mortgage Brokers Classified as Financiers?

When tackling the complex world of mortgages, it's vital to appreciate the role of a mortgage broker. These specialists act as connectors between borrowers and lenders, helping individuals obtain the financing they need for their dream homes. However, a common inquisition arises: are mortgage brokers essentially financiers?

Although mortgage brokers don't inherently offer money like traditional financial institutions, their role in the mortgage process is indispensable. They have a comprehensive knowledge of the credit landscape and can match borrowers with the most suitable loan programs. This competence makes them valuable tools for borrowers navigating the challenges of mortgage acquisition

  • Furthermore, mortgage brokers often negotiate on behalf of borrowers, aiming to acquire the best possible financing conditions. This can consequently in significant cost reductions for individuals seeking financing.
  • In essence, while mortgage brokers may not be traditional financiers, their influence on the financing process is undeniable. They facilitate borrowers by providing expertise and aiding them to make informed financial decisions
